Comprehending Bi-Fold Doors
Before diving into the repair procedure, it's vital to comprehend the elements of a bi-fold door. Bi-fold doors include several panels that fold together, enabling them to move along a track. The main parts consist of:
Panels: These are the specific areas of the door that fold and slide.Track: The horizontal or vertical path along which the panels move.Rollers: Small wheels attached to the top and bottom of each panel, permitting them to slide efficiently.Hinges: Connect the panels to each other and to the frame.Manages: Used to open and close the doors.Modification Screws: Allow for tweak the alignment of the panels.Typical Issues and DIY Fixes
Sticking Doors
Trigger: Dust, dirt, or particles in the track can trigger the doors to stick.Solution: Clean the track with a vacuum or a soft brush. Apply a silicone lube to the rollers to guarantee smooth movement.
Misaligned Panels
Trigger: Over time, the panels can become misaligned due to wear and tear or incorrect installation.Solution: Adjust the alignment screws situated at the top and bottom of the panels. Turn the screws clockwise to raise the panel and counterclockwise to lower it.
Broken Rollers
Cause: Rollers can break or break, causing the doors to jam or not slide at all.Service: Replace the damaged rollers with brand-new ones. Guarantee the new rollers are the exact same size and type as the old ones.
Loose Hinges
Cause: Hinges can end up being loose with time, leading to wobbly panels.Service: Tighten the hinge screws. If the screws are stripped, utilize longer screws or fill the holes with wood filler before reinserting the screws.
Damaged Panels

Q: How much does bi-fold door repair expense?A: The cost of bi-fold door repair can differ depending upon the extent of the damage and the components that need to be replaced. Easy repairs, such as cleaning the track or changing the alignment, might cost around ₤ 50 to ₤ 100. More intricate repairs, such as replacing rollers or panels, can vary from ₤ 100 to ₤ 300 or more.

Q: Can I repair a bi-fold door myself?A: Many small concerns can be resolved with DIY solutions, such as cleaning up the track or changing the alignment. However, for more complicated repairs, it's finest to seek advice from an expert to make sure the job is done correctly and securely.

Q: How long does bi-fold bifold door track repair repair take?A: Simple repairs can be finished in a few hours, while more intricate repairs may take a full day or longer. The period will depend on the extent of the damage and the accessibility of replacement parts.

Q: What should I look for in a bi-fold door repair service?A: Look for a service that has experience with bi-fold doors, favorable evaluations from previous clients, and a clear interaction procedure. Guarantee they use a service warranty on their work and are licensed and guaranteed.

Q: Can I avoid bi-fold door problems?A: Regular maintenance can help avoid numerous typical problems. Tidy the track and rollers regularly, lube the moving parts, and examine the alignment periodically. Attend to any small concerns immediately to avoid them from ending up being more major.
